How Our Residential Water Extraction Service Works
When you need Residential Water Extraction, our team springs into action. We understand the importance of a proper process, and we’ve developed a system that ensures your property is restored quickly and efficiently. By following our proven steps, we reduce the risk of further damage and get your life back to normal.
Step 1: Assessment and Planning
Our technicians arrive on-site to assess the damage and create a customized plan for extraction and restoration. We use specialized equipment to detect hidden moisture and identify areas that need attention.
Step 2: Water Extraction
Our team uses industrial-grade pumps and extractors to remove standing water and saturated materials. We work quickly to prevent further damage and reduce the risk of mold growth.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
Our technicians use specialized equipment to dry and dehumidify your property, ensuring that all surfaces are completely dry and free of moisture.
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ing
We thoroughly clean and sanitize all affected areas, removing any remaining water and debris. This step is crucial in preventing the growth of mold and bacteria.
Step 5: Restoration and Repair
Our team works with you to restore your property to its pre-damage condition. This may include repairs, replacement of damaged materials, and refinishing or repainting.

Residential Water Extraction Cost in Dahlonega, GA
Prices for Residential Water Extraction in Dahlonega, GA, vary based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. These estimates are based on real-world costs and may vary depending on your specific situation.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ction (small area) |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, equipment needed |
| Water Extraction (large area) | $2,500 – $10,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, equipment needed |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, equipment needed |
| Cleaning and Sanitizing |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, equipment needed |
| Restoration and Repair | $2,500 – $10,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, materials needed |
Exact pricing depends on an on-site assessment. Contact us for a free estimate and to schedule your Residential Water Extraction service.
